Tiarella 'Slickrock'

Tiarella 'Slickrock' is a fast-spreading perennial with small, maple-like leaves and delicate light pink flowers that bloom in spring. This woodland plant is ideal for dry shade and part sun to light shade conditions. It is known for its resilience against rabbits and its ability to thrive in various US climates. Its rapid growth makes it a popular choice for ground cover in gardens.

Tiarella cordifolia 'Oconee Spreader'

Tiarella cordifolia 'Oconee Spreader' is a vigorous groundcover with glossy green leaf rosettes. It forms a large 8-foot wide patch in 5 years and produces bottlebrush-like spikes of white flowers in spring. This plant is rabbit resistant and thrives in part sun to light shade.

Tiarella 'Pinwheel'

Tiarella 'Pinwheel' is a charming perennial with large, three-lobed green leaves accented by a narrow purple stripe. In spring, it produces delicate white bottle brush flowers. This woodland plant is ideal for shaded areas and is resistant to rabbits, making it a low-maintenance choice for gardens.
